Venezuelan Children Flock to See Santana on His Trip Home  —  TOVAR, Venezuela — The residents here like to tell the story of how a scout, impressed by Johan Santana's performance at a junior national tournament, drove 10 hours to this small coffee-growing town 6,400 feet up in the Andes to knock unannounced on his parents' door.
